What to Do If You’ve Been Scammed by a Gambling Website
Recognizing the Scam
Discovering that you’ve been scammed by a gambling website can be a frustrating and disheartening experience. However, it’s essential to remain calm and take the necessary steps to protect yourself and potentially recover your losses. The first step is to recognize that you’ve fallen victim to a scam. Common signs of a gambling website scam include unrealistically high odds of winning, delays or issues with payouts, unresponsive customer service, and a lack of transparency in their terms and conditions. Trust your gut feelings and any red flags that may have arisen during your experience.
Collecting Evidence
Once you’ve identified that you’ve been scammed, the next step is to gather as much evidence as possible. This documentation will be crucial in reporting the scam and potentially assisting in recovering your funds. Keep records of all communications, including emails, chat logs, and screenshots of any suspicious activity.
In addition to documenting your interactions with the gambling website, gather evidence of your financial transactions, such as bank statements, credit card receipts, or digital payment records. This evidence will help support your claim and provide a clear paper trail for authorities or legal action.
Contacting the Gambling Website
After you’ve collected the necessary evidence, it’s time to reach out to the gambling website directly. Take note of their contact information, including their phone number, email address, or live chat support. Initiate communication and express your concerns regarding the scam.
During your interaction, try to remain calm and composed. Clearly explain the situation, provide any evidence you have, and request a resolution. Keep a record of your conversation, including the date and time of contact, the names of any customer service representatives you spoke with, and a summary of what was discussed.
Filing a Complaint with the Appropriate Authorities
If your attempts to contact the gambling website directly are unsuccessful or unsatisfactory, it’s crucial to escalate the matter further. Research the appropriate authorities in your jurisdiction responsible for regulating gambling websites.
File a formal complaint with these authorities, providing all relevant evidence, and detailing your experience, including your attempts to resolve the issue with the gambling website. Depending on your jurisdiction, these authorities may vary, but they often include gambling commissions, consumer protection agencies, or financial regulatory bodies.
Seeking Legal Advice
If you’ve exhausted all other avenues without receiving a satisfactory outcome, it may be necessary to seek legal advice. Consult with a lawyer who specializes in gambling or consumer law to determine the best course of action.
Present your case to the lawyer, providing them with all the evidence and documentation you have collected. They will guide you on the most appropriate legal steps, such as initiating a lawsuit or joining a class-action lawsuit if others have also been scammed by the same gambling website.
